Follow-up to my own post... I figured out that even if you cut it down, the 590 heat shield won't fit or work with a 14" barrel, the front end is made for the taper of an 18-20" barrel, and the forward tab with the two bolts is going to block the fore-end from cycling all the way forward and closing the bolt. Also, the two bolt-holes in the heat shield's front tabs are partially blocked by the barrel itself if you can get it on there.

There is a company that can do a 14" heat shield, but I don't know if it'll fit a ghost-ring/rifle blade front sight barrel. They charge $158, and need to get your barrel, because they need to tap the sides of the magazine tube retainer ring on the barrel to make a mounting point for the reasons I discovered above.
View Quote


To add to this information. If you have the Surefire 621 forearm there is no gap at all between the forearm and the barrel lug. The forearm covers nearly half of the lug so any drilling and tapping of the lug may want to take this into consideration to avoid interference.
